
Reflexology is a therapeutic practice based on the principle that specific points on the feet — reflex points — correspond to organs and systems throughout the body. By applying precise thumb and finger pressure to these points, a trained reflexologist stimulates the body's own healing responses, improves circulation and releases tension far beyond the feet themselves.
It is not a foot rub. A proper reflexology session follows a structured map of the feet, working systematically through zones connected to the spine, digestive system, head and neck, and more. 1. Deep relaxation — reflexology is remarkably calming; many clients drift into a near-sleep state within minutes. 2. Better sleep — it is one of the most common things clients report after a session or two. 3. Reduced stress and anxiety — working the reflex zones settles the nervous system in a way that lingers for days. 4. Improved circulation — especially valued by people who are on their feet all day or sit at a desk all week. 5. Relief for tired, aching feet and legs — the most immediate and obvious win.
Reflexology is also a lovely option for people who want the benefits of a treatment but prefer not to have a full-body massage — you stay fully clothed apart from your feet and lower legs.
You will relax in a comfortable reclined position while your therapist works through both feet with focused, wave-like pressure — firm enough to feel purposeful, never painful. Some points may feel tender; that is normal and usually eases as the point releases.
